Quattro tracking required - recommendations

Featured Replies

Hi All,

I'm pretty sure the tracking on my Q5 Quattro needs doing.

The local Audi approved (not Audi dealership) has quoted £87 to do it.

Would you trust a local 'tyre' place to do it, if it was less than £50?  eg, Kwik-Fit, National Tyre Autocentre, Halfords Autocentre, F1 Autocentre.

Thanks,

Joe

Hello Joe,

In my experience, most now have sophisticated equipment - great! Experience and interest to use it properly??  How many times do you hear of people driving away after getting alignment adjusted, and find the steering  wheel is off centre? 
Yes, they clamped it in the straight ahead position, but….

The objective is to get it done once and properly. I trust my local   (In caps) ATS tyre outlet, but I wouldn’t take that across the board. 
 

Cheaper can be good, but no more often that expensive not guaranteeing better! 
I would be asking about for recommendations of your ‘Audi Approved’ and use them if (in caps) you are led to believe they are good.
